I have completely uninstall Exchange from the old mail server where the BlackBerry Professional Services is installed. I installed the CDO on to the server, this was done this past Thursday. I thought the issue resolved. However this past weekend the Dispatcher service got disconnected twice in two days. Below is a sampling of the errors that are appearing in the Event Viewer:
Event ID 50097 - [SRP]Dispatcher\SRP connection dropped, Error=0
Event ID 20000 - SRPClient::Connect: Error calling host "localhost" [127.0.0.1] (0)
Event ID 20460 - [SRP] Connection failed
The next two errors, I'm not sure if they mean anything
Event ID 45058 - {StartNotifyThreadServer} DBNS component not installed
Event ID 20000 - [BIPPe] Warning using default BIPP shared Secret
Any other Ideas?
